World's major courts take growing role in climate fight
Posted
The world's top court is poised to tell governments what their legal obligations are to tackle global warming, and possibly outline consequences for polluters that cause climate harm to vulnerable countries. But the potentially more controversial request is what -- if any -- legal consequences there might be for major polluters who cause severe climate damages.
